  • Among the most intensely admired composers in jazz, Wayne Shorter is a true legend whose career stretched over half a century. The golden era of this saxophonist’s extraordinary musical journey was marked by the formation of his quartet with Danilo Pérez, John Patitucci, and Brian Blade, who went forth to confound all preconceptions of jazz in a prolific 24 years of concerts and GRAMMY® Award-winning recordings. Shorter’s great musical legacy lives on through this kindred trio, as they take to Zero Gravity—a shared fearlessness espoused by their mentor and Zen guru. Frequently hailed as one of the most influential saxophonists of his generation, Mark Turner rounds out this inspired exploration of the unknown. Performing their own interpretations of Shorter’s compositions, this quartet seeks to honor his pivotal contributions to jazz.
